Not sure about the AD-series as i've only been inside one and it was a while back. But my 90's OR-120 is loaded almost completely with 1/2W carbon film resistors. All the mfd range caps are polyprop box caps. All the pf range are the old style silver micas. I can't remember the manufacturer off the top of my head though, i'd have to open the amp up.
My 70's GRO100 is loaded with old WIMA polyester film box caps for just about everything. Actually...that whole amp is WIMA's. The resistors appear to be old 1/2W carbon films. They don't look like carbon comps to me, but I could be wrong.
And I think the newer Oranges use trannys from a company called Douglas Louth in England. I ordered an AD140 OT from Orange to go in my OR120 as a replacement and that's what they gave me. I also have an AD15 PT that I got from Orange which is the same manufacturer.
